SPECTRE1 -

One of the finest SF soldiers I ever knew started his career as a cook. That's what I said, a simple cook. Was a fine cook, respectful to his pears, a job well done each and every day. When he went to the SSG/E6 board, the board Pres./SGM asked, "Sergeant, what would you have changed about your career thus far in the US Army?", His answer was, "Nothing Sergeant Major, my career so far has been everything I expected from the US Army."

"Sergeant. Is there anything you would like to ask the board before we conclude this review?" "Yes Sergeant Major, I would like the opportunity to attend the Special Forces Qualification Course conducted at Ft. Bragg, NC before my time in the United Stated Army is finished."

"Very well Sergeant, dismissed."

"Thank you Sergeant Major. Thank you board members."

Be the best you can be in all you do. Don't worry about finding us, if you possess attributes and attitudes that are in line with Special Forces, trust us, we will find you.
